Title: The Innovations of Naruaki Tomita
Introduction
Naruaki Tomita is a notable inventor based in Yokohama, Japan, recognized for his contributions to the field of glass processing and energy storage technologies. With a total of five patents to his name, his work showcases the application of innovative solutions to complex engineering challenges.
Latest Patents
Naruaki Tomita's recent patents demonstrate his focus on advancing both glass technology and capacitor design. His innovations include:
1. **Conduit for Molten Glass** - This patent outlines a metal conduit designed to manage thermal expansion and contraction, as well as vibration, during the transport of molten glass. By incorporating convex portions that extend radially, this conduit ensures stability and efficiency in transportation systems for glass manufacturing.
2. **Vacuum Degassing Apparatus** - Along with the conduit, this invention enhances the vacuum degassing process by addressing the issues caused by thermal changes and vibrations, making it a significant advancement in the production of high-quality glass products.
3. **Electric Double-Layer Capacitor** - Tomita's work also extends to electrical engineering with a patented electric double-layer capacitor featuring low internal resistance and high capacitance per unit volume. This innovation is essential for improving energy retention in capacitors and demonstrates his ability to contribute to multiple fields of technology.
Career Highlights
Naruaki Tomita is affiliated with Asahi Glass Company, Limited, where he applies his expertise in engineering and material science. His role at this leading glass manufacturing company has enabled him to leverage his patents for practical applications that enhance product performance.
